The invention of scanning devices provides an easy means of converting hard copy document to softcopy which could have been otherwise impossible. However, the main challenge with the use of scanning devices is that the documents are transferred as images which makes them impossible to edit. The invention of the Optical Character Recognition (OCT) technology proffers a solution that allows users to scan documents in an editable format.
